Abstract
An approach is described that includes determining that a remote device has moved outside of a pre-defined area associated with a digital video recorder (DVR), and transmitting program data from the DVR to the remote device while the remote device remains outside of the pre-defined area. Another approach includes a digital video recorder (DVR) having a memory and a processor. The DVR operates to: receive an incoming transmission signal; transmit a selected program to a primary display device; determine that a remote device has moved outside of a pre-defined area; and transmit program data corresponding to the selected program to the remote device while the remote device remains outside of the pre-defined area.

13. A method, comprising:
providing a computing infrastructure that operates to; receive an incoming transmission signal at a digital video recorder (DVR); transmit a selected program from the DVR to a primary display device; determine that a remote device has moved outside of a pre-defined area associated with one of the DVR and the primary display device; transmit program data from the DVR to the remote device while the remote device remains outside of the pre-defined area; and cease transmitting the program data to the remote device when the DVR determines that the remote device has moved back inside the pre-defined area, wherein the program data transmitted to the remote device corresponds to the selected program that is transmitted to the primary display device; the determining that the remote device has moved outside of the pre-defined area comprises one of;
transmitting a locating signal from the DVR to the remote device and awaiting a return signal from the remote device; and
comparing GPS location data of the remote device to data defining the pre-defined area; andthe transmitting the program data from the DVR to the remote device comprises one of;
transmitting the program data directly from the DVR to the remote device wirelessly; and
transmitting the program data from the DVR to a wireless transmitter in a local area network (LAN) to which the DVR is connected.
